In response to the many requests from the region’s fans, May’n will return to Singapore for AFA this year with new songs and a brand new performance experience.
At AFA08, May’n attracted a crowd of over 8,000 people all over South-east Asia, including Japan, delivering an unforgettable experience for all. Since then, she has moved further in her career and embarked on a solo concert tour in January 2009 and July-August 2009 with a total of 14 sell-out concerts.
Her first solo concert at Nippon Budokan has just been announced and will take place on January 24th 2010. Her work as the singing voice of Sheryl Nome from Macross Frontier has been given another dimension: the theatrical version will appear on the silver screen on November 21st. May’n is surely on her way to become a rising star in Japan.


Multi-talented (Actress, Cosplayer, Voice Actress, Illustrator, Manga-ka, Idol, and Blogger!) Shoko Nakagawa will perform in AFA09’s “I Love Anisong” act.
Her debut single “Brilliant Dream” was launched back in July 2006. 2 singles later, “Sorairo Days”, her 3rd single and opening theme to Tengen Toppa Gurren Lagann, became a smash hit in Japan in 2007, and she participated in the Red and White (Kohaku) Singing Contest, NHK’s year-end music show at the same year. Shoko has continuously released hit singles such as “Snow Tears”, “Tsuzuku Sekai “and “Namida no Tane, Egao no Hana”, and, since “Sorairo Days”, 7 of her singles have made into Oricon Top 10 weekly charts.
She is multitalented and her activities are endless, ranging from being an idol, voice actress, comic artist to blogger. From August 23 to 27, Shoko traveled to a depth of 5200m on the “Shinkai 6500”, a deep submergence research vehicle, and became the first talent who made such a descent.


Ichirou Mizuki, Japan’s “King of Anime Songs”, has confirmed that he will come back to Anime Festival Asia 2009 (AFA09) to perform at AFA09’s “I Love Anisong”
Better known as “Aniki” (meaning older brother) by industry and anime fans alike, Ichirou Mizuki began his career in 1968, with the theme of “Genshi Shonen Ryu”. Since then, he has performed over 1200 songs including songs for “Mazinger Z”, “Captain Harlock” and Tokusatsu (meaning Sci-fi or fantasy) shows, such as “Masked Rider”. He has gained international recognition as Japan’s most prominent Anime performer in his 40 year career as a singer for Anime songs.


Member of JAM Project. Guitarist, singer, and songwriter, Yoshiki Fukuyama will be performing at Anime Festival Asia 2009 in “I Love Anisong” act for the first time ever in Singapore!
Inspired by Queen, Yoshiki Fukuyama started his career as a musician in 1988. In 1994, he played the singing role and guitarist of “Macross 7” main role Basara Nekki and became known on an international level. He had won the Japan Gold Disk Award for “The Best Anime Album of the year.”

Next is the Regional Cosplay Championship. The top cosplay team from each South East Asian country will be sponsored by AFA09 to compete in the Regional Cosplay Championship during the two-day anime festival where they will perform and be judged by a panel of distinguished guests from Japan including internationally renowned cosplayer Kaname. As seen from the flags, it includes Phillphines, Indonesia, Singapore, Malaysia and Thailand.
The guest judge for the event will be KANAME.

In conjunction with the 30th anniversary of theGundam franchise, Bandai, Anime Festival Asia (AFA) and Danny Choo is running an online Gundam modeling competition to celebrate this most awesome occasion – introducing the Bandai World Gunpla Competition. It can be access from figure.am.
The catorgatories are
- Coolest free-style Gunpla
- Cutest Super-Deformed (SD) Gundam
- Coolest Gundam diorama
- Most amusing Gunpla
